ACCREDITATION / RECOGNITION
Institutional Accreditation
Southern Association of Colleges and Schools (SACS) 
Year of first Accreditation
1879
Other Accreditations
Commission on Collegiate Nursing Education (CCNE); Association to Advance Collegiate Schools of Business (AACSB International); American Association for Leisure and Recreation (AALR), Council on Accreditation; Council on Accreditation of Nurse Anesthesia Educational Programs (AANA); American Bar Association (ABA), Council of the Section of Legal Education and Admissions to the Bar; Accreditation Board for Engineering and Technology (ABET); Accrediting Council on Education in Journalism and Mass Communications (ACEJMC); Association for Clinical Pastoral Education (ACPEAC), Accreditation Commission; American Chemical Society (ACS); American Library Association (ALA), Committee on Accreditation; American Psychological Association (APA); American Speech-Language-Hearing Association (ASHA), Council on Academic Accreditation in Audiology and Speech-Language Pathology; American Veterinary Medical Association (AVMA), Council on Education; Council for Accreditation of Counseling and Related Educational Programs (CACREP); American Dietetic Association, Commission on Accreditation for Dietetics Education (CADE); Council on Education for Public Health (CEPH); Council on Rehabilitation Education (CORE); Council on Social Work Education (CSWE); Foundation for Interior Design Education and Research (FIDER); Joint Review Committee on Educational Programs in Nuclear Medicine Technology (JRCNMT); National Architectural Accrediting Board (NAAB); National Association of Schools of Art and Design (NASAD), Commission on Accreditation; National Association of Schools of Music (NASM), Commission on Accreditation; National Association of Schools of Public Affairs and Administration (NASPAA), Commission on Peer Review and Accreditation; National Council for Accreditation of Teacher Education (NCATE); Society of American Foresters (SAF)
